Engine Yard Developer Center

Windows からの SSH 鍵の作成と追加

このドキュメントは英語版のドキュメントを日本語に翻訳したものです。原文に修正があった場合は随時反映致しますが、翻訳作業が完了するまでは英語版が最新の可能性がございます。


Windows では、RailsInstaller、PuTTY、Cygwin など、SSH キー ペアを作成するさまざまな方法があります。Engine Yard は、操作が簡単であることを理由に RailsInstaller を使用する方法をサポートしています。

SSH キー ペアの作成は 2 段階です。

キーを作成する方法

RailsInstaller では ~/.ssh C:\Users\<user_name>\.ssh に SSH キーが自動的に作成されます。再作成するには、以下の手順に従います。この手順では、git-bash に使用されていることを理由に UNIX スタイルのコマンドとパスを使用します。

  1. [スタート]、[プログラム]、[RailsInstaller]、[git-bash] に移動します。

  2. ディレクトリをホーム フォルダーに変更します。

    cd ~ 
  3. SSH キーを生成します (強力なパスワードを使用してください。そうでない場合は、Engine Yard Cloud によってパスワードが拒否されます)。

    ssh-keygen -t rsa 
  4. SSH フォルダーおよびキーへのアクセス許可を変更します。

    chmod -R 644 ~/.ssh 

非公開キー ~/.ssh/id_rsa と公開キー ~/.ssh/id_rsa.pub が作成されました。

Engine Yard Cloud にキーを追加する方法

  1. ローカル コンピューターで公開キーを見つけてコピーします。

    a. メモ帳で公開キー (~/.ssh/id_rsa.pub) を開きます。

    notepad ~/.ssh/id_rsa.pub

    b. キーをクリップボードにコピーします。

  2. ダッシュボードで [SSH Public Keys (SSH 公開キー)] をクリックします。

  3. [Add new SSH public key (新しい SSH 公開キーの追加)] をクリックします。

  4. キーを識別するために、[Name (名前)] フィールドに名前を入力します。

  5. メモ帳で公開キー (~/.ssh/id_rsa.pub) を開きます。

    notepad ~/.ssh/id_rsa.pub 
  6. 手順 1b でコピーしたキーを [Public Key (公開キー)] フィールドに貼り付けます。

  7. このキーを追加する環境を選択します。環境がない場合は、環境を作成するとこのキーが自動的に追加されます。

  8. [Add Key (キーの追加)] をクリックします。
    SSH 公開キーが作成され、Engine Yard アカウントに追加されたことを知らせる確認メッセージが表示されます。

次の手順

公開キーをアプリケーション環境にインストールします。


このページに関してフィードバックやご質問がございましたら、以下にコメントを入力してください。サポートが必要な場合は、Engine Yard サポートにチケットを送信してください。

この記事は役に立ちましたか?
0人中0人がこの記事が役に立ったと言っています
他にご質問がございましたら、リクエストを送信してください

コメント

ログインしてコメントを残してください。

Powered by Zendesk